The automotive industry, in which the TACHI-S group is involved, has currently entered a once-in-a-century transformation period with the development of CASE and MaaS, and is also facing a changing global environment with increasing uncertainty.
In order to achieve sustainable growth in the future, the TACHI-S group will drastically change the way it has been doing business and aim to become an independent company that can provide not only economic value but also social value.
In this environment, TACHI-S has formulated the medium-term management plan “Transformative Value Evolution (TVE)” for the period from FY2021 to FY2024.
The word “TVE” expresses our will to “evolve our values and provide new values through self-transformation in this era of great change”.
TVE's basic approach is to expand our business domain through three types of “Shinkha”: “Deepening,” “Innovating” and “Renewing,” which indicate the direction of our business, and to increase our corporate value by proactively investing for further growth as returning the achievements to our stakeholders.
In pursuing this business strategy, we will focus on the following three key activities: Strengthening Monozukuri competitiveness, Strengthening organizational sales capabilities, and Strengthening management foundation. We will also work to promote DX, which will serve as the foundation for these activities.
In addition to our business strategy, we have also formulated new financial and capital strategies centered on the implementation of capital cost-conscious management.
Through all of these activities, we will continue to provide economic and social value to all of our stakeholders, and promote our corporate activities toward the realization of a sustainable society.
